In October 2022, AS Tallink Grupp transported 454 207 passengers, which is a 10.2% increase compared to October 2021. The number of cargo units decreased by 3.5% to 32 959 units and the number of passenger vehicles decreased by 2.7% to 62 213 units in the same comparison.
AS Tallink Grupp passenger, cargo unit and passenger vehicles numbers for October 2022 were the following:
October 2022 | October 2021 | Change | |
Passengers | 454 207 | 412 046 | 10.2% |
Finland – Sweden | 159 200 | 162 758 | -2.2% |
Estonia – Finland | 252 558 | 210 260 | 20.1% |
Estonia – Sweden | 42 449 | 39 028 | 8.8% |
Cargo Units | 32 959 | 34 138 | -3.5% |
Finland – Sweden | 4 251 | 6 685 | -36.4% |
Estonia – Finland | 25 219 | 22 073 | 14.3% |
Estonia – Sweden | 3 489 | 5 380 | -35.1% |
Passenger Vehicles | 62 213 | 63 923 | -2.7% |
Finland – Sweden | 5 257 | 6 742 | -22.0% |
Estonia – Finland | 54 922 | 54 242 | 1.3% |
Estonia – Sweden | 2 034 | 2 939 | -30.8% |
FINLAND – SWEDEN
October results reflect operations of Turku-Kapellskär and Helsinki-Stockholm routes. The cruise ferry Galaxy stopped operating on the Turku-Stockholm route in September 2022 due to a charter contract.
ESTONIA – FINLAND
October results reflect operations of shuttle services.
ESTONIA – SWEDEN
October results reflect operations of Tallinn-Stockholm and Paldiski-Kapellskär routes. The cargo ship Sailor underwent maintenance works until October 28, 2022.
